Strengthening the flotation recovery of silver using a special ceramic ...

Strengthening the flotation recovery of silver using a special ceramic ...

Strengthening the flotation recovery of silver by fine grinding with special ceramicmedium stirred mill (SCSM), steel ballmedium stirred mill (SBSM) and ball mill (BM) were investigated, respectively. Grinding with SCSM exhibited better performance in terms of Ag recovery, which was approximately 2% higher than those obtained by grinding with SBSM and BM.

The Mercury Problem in Artisanal and Small‐Scale Gold Mining

The Mercury Problem in Artisanal and Small‐Scale Gold Mining

The amalgamation process may be repeated 3 or 4 times to maximize gold extraction. 19a The combined mercurygold amalgams are then strained through cloth to remove excess liquid mercury and provide a mercurygold amalgam ball (Figure 2 D). These amalgams are typically between 40 % and 80 % mercury by mass. 19a

Ball mill Wikipedia

Ball mill Wikipedia

A ball mill is a type of grinder used to grind or blend materials for use in mineral dressing processes, paints, pyrotechnics, ceramics, and selective laser sintering. It works on the principle of impact and attrition: size reduction is done by impact as the balls drop from near the top of the shell.

Gold CIL CIP Gold Leaching Process Explained CCD 911 Metallurgist

Gold CIL CIP Gold Leaching Process Explained CCD 911 Metallurgist

The carboninpulp process is used to treat low grade gold and/or silver ores. The ore is first ground in a ball mill which operates in closed circuit with a cyclone or similar sizing device. This is done to produce a feed suitably sized so that subsequent leaching is rapid.
